Kinds Of Cheap Fireplaces
When browsing for a budget-friendly fireplace, several types are available that deal with different budget plans and home styles. Below is a list of some common classifications of low-cost fireplaces:
1. Electric FireplacesSummary: These fireplaces use electricity to produce heat and mimic the appearance of genuine flames.Pros: No emissions, simple installation, and adjustable heat settings.Cons: Higher electric bills, not ideal for all looks.2. Gas FireplacesOverview: Rely on natural gas or lp to produce genuine flames.Pros: Efficient heat output, immediate heat, and frequently featured remote controls.Cons: Requires gas line installation, which may sustain extra expenses.3. Wood-Burning StovesIntroduction: These traditional fireplaces burn wood logs to produce heat and atmosphere.Pros: Lower running expenses if wood is sourced locally, genuine experience.Cons: Requires more maintenance, a chimney system, and sourcing firewood.4. Bioethanol FireplacesOverview: Use bioethanol to develop genuine flames without being connected to a flue.Pros: Portable, easy to set up, and produces little smoke.Cons: Limited heat output and can be costly if utilized regularly.5. When picking a cheap fireplace, several aspects should be taken into consideration to guarantee that the purchase aligns with your home's requirements and budget plan:

Space and Size
Assess the size of the space where the fireplace will be set up. Bigger rooms may require more powerful heating alternatives, whereas smaller sized spaces might benefit from compact electric or bioethanol designs.
Fuel Type
Pick in between electric, gas, wood, or bioethanol based on availability, personal choice, and regional regulations regarding emissions and security.
Installation Requirements
Consider whether the fireplace requires substantial installation work, such as venting and chimney building, which can considerably increase costs.
Expense of Operation
Calculate the continuous fuel or electricity costs to keep heat throughout the cold weather.
Aesthetic Design
Choose a fireplace that complements the existing design of your home, whether modern, traditional, or rustic.Upkeep Tips for Your Fireplace
When a cheap fireplace is set up, appropriate maintenance is vital for safety and durability. Here are some vital upkeep suggestions:
Schedule Annual Inspections: For gas and wood-burning fireplaces, it's vital to have an annual assessment to look for gas leakages or clogs in the chimney.Regular Cleaning: Dust and keep electric fireplaces and tidy out ash from wood-burning ranges to avoid fire risks.Appropriate Fuel Storage: For wood-burning ranges, store fire wood in a dry area to ensure effective burning and avoid mold growth.Usage Quality Fuel: Always use appropriate fuel for gas and bioethanol fireplaces to prevent excess soot and emissions.Set Up Carbon Monoxide Detectors: For gas or wood-burning designs, set up detectors to make sure that any leak of damaging gases is quickly determined.FAQs1. What is the cheapest type of fireplace?
Electric fireplaces are generally among the most inexpensive options, using a range of costs that can fit most budgets.
2. Can I install a fireplace myself to conserve money?
While some electric and bioethanol fireplaces can be quickly set up without expert assistance, gas and wood-burning models typically require installation by a qualified service technician to ensure security.
3. For how long do electric fireplaces last?
Electric fireplaces can last for several years with proper care, normally around 10-15 years, depending upon use and the quality of the system.
4. What is the most efficient fireplace?
Gas fireplaces tend to be the most effective, supplying instant heat with controlled emissions.
5. How do I know if my fireplace is safe to use?
Routine examinations, correct cleaning, and making sure that there are no blockages or leakages can assist preserve security in any type of fireplace.
